The direct liquid introduction (DLI) interface was designed in 1980. This interface was meant to address the issue of evaporation of liquid Within the capillary inlet interface. In DLI, a small part of the LC flow was pressured by way of a compact aperture or diaphragm (generally 10um in diameter) to sort a liquid jet made up of little droplets which were subsequently dried in a desolvation chamber.[eleven] The analytes had been ionized utilizing a solvent assisted chemical ionization source, exactly where the LC solvents acted as reagent gases. To make use of this interface, it absolutely was needed to break up the flow coming out in the LC column for the reason that only a little portion of the effluent (ten to fifty μl/min from one ml/min) may very well be released into your source without having boosting the vacuum force of the MS system too substantial.

In ion-exchange chromatography (IC), retention is based about the attraction between solute ions and charged web pages certain to the stationary phase. Solute ions of the identical demand as being the billed web-sites about the column are excluded from binding, even though solute ions of the opposite cost in the billed internet sites with the column are retained on the column.
